ROLE OVERVIEW
NAPA Physiotherapists provide services to develop, enhance or restore functional capacity of clients whose abilities to cope with the tasks of daily living are impaired by physical illness or injury, psychosocial disabilities, aging process or by developmental deficits.
Physiotherapists at NAPA Centre provide skillful intervention to infants, toddlers, children, and adolescents with disorders that affect development of motor and behavioural skills within the professional scope of practice. The role will require all therapists to work as part of a multi-disciplinary team. It is expected that each therapist will be able to complete most of the below responsibilities autonomously with supervision available however minimally required.
RESPONSIBILITIES – KEY RESPONSIBILTY AREAS
Provision of Clinical Care

Display a level of professional empathy towards clients and the ability to develop rapport. Maintain appropriate professional boundaries with clients and their families.

Develop rapport with clients to build a relationship of trust and mutual respect.

Treatment of motor deficits and functional impairments or difficulties primarily in the paediatric population

Possess general knowledge of child development to assess and refer families to other disciplines when appropriate

Assess a client’s physical condition using a variety of standardised tools to determine a plan for treatment.

Utilise multiple frames of reference to inform practice including but not limited to: neurodevelopmental, developmental biomechanical, sensory integration, motor learning, cognitive, and rehabilitation.

Create tailored treatment plans to address client’s limitations, taking into account their age, abilities and other medical/physical factors.

Apply a range of physiotherapy techniques to address presented conditions (including tailored exercises, passive and active stretching, gait analysis and training).

Patient/caregiver training in the use of assistive technology devices, mobility devices, orthotic or prosthetic devices.

Prescribe home exercise programs for patient/caregiver to promote carryover and continued progress in the community.

Adapt environments and processes to enhance functional performance of clients.

REQUIREMENTS: QUALIFICATION, EXPERIENCE & SKILLS
• Minimum qualifications include completion of a Physiotherapy degree, from an accredited University.

Clinical experience – 1-2 years post graduate Physiotherapy experience, preferably in paediatrics

Current Working with Children Check & NDIS Workers Screening Check.

CPR and First Aid certificates.

Current registration with AHPRA.

Current Professional Indemnity Insurance.

Current Medicare Provider Number

Good Physical health and fitness and the ability to:

Lift up to 20 kg, extended periods of standing and/or sitting on the floor.

Independently pivot or complete a standing transfer dependent patients up to 38kg

Independently offer contact guard assistance for ambulatory patients of up to 57kg

Maintain extended periods of standing and/or sitting on the floor for up to 7 hours per day

Move from floor to standing position back to floor frequently (6-7 hours) throughout the day
